A recruitment agency is seeking a dedicated Primary School Teacher for Years 3-5 in Heywood. The ideal candidate will possess Qualified Teacher Status (QTS) and extensive experience in managing classroom behaviour. You will be responsible for delivering engaging lessons aligned with the national curriculum and nurturing a positive learning environment.
This role offers competitive pay ranging from £140 to £240 per day and the opportunity to work in a supportive school setting.

How to prepare for a job interview at CAREER CHOICES DEWIS GYRFA LTD.
✨Know Your Curriculum
Make sure you’re well-versed in the national curriculum for Years 3-5. Brush up on key subjects and be ready to discuss how you would deliver engaging lessons that meet these standards. This shows your commitment to providing quality education.
✨Showcase Your Classroom Management Skills
Prepare examples of how you've successfully managed classroom behaviour in the past. Think about specific strategies you've used to create a positive learning environment and be ready to share these during the interview.
✨Engage with the School's Values
Research the school’s ethos and values before the interview. Be prepared to explain how your teaching philosophy aligns with their approach, especially in fostering a supportive atmosphere for students.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are some insightful questions to ask at the end of your interview. This could be about the school's support systems for teachers or how they encourage professional development. It shows your genuine interest in the role and the school.
